4. Educational Content
Positioning your brand as a knowledgeable authority in your industry is an excellent strategy for building trust and engagement. Providing useful educational content that informs your audience can lead them to view your business as a go-to resource.
Consider creating how-to guides, tips, or industry insights in your emails. For instance, a small business in the home improvement sector might send out a seasonal checklist for homeowners about necessary repairs. This kind of content addresses customer needs while showcasing your expertise.
Be sure to send articles, infographics, or video tutorials directly related to your business. This kind of valuable content not only draws in the audience but keeps them engaged and coming back for more.
5. Engage with Polls and Surveys
Interactive content is a compelling way to engage your audience and gather valuable feedback. Polls and surveys not only invite customers to share their opinions but also foster a sense of community.
In your emails, consider including quick polls asking for customer preferences, such as “What type of products would you like to see more of?” This not only encourages interaction but gives you insights into customer preferences, allowing you to tailor future content and products accordingly.
By actively involving your audience, you strengthen the relationship between your business and your customers, making them feel valued and heard.
6. User-Generated Content
Encouraging your customers to share their own experiences with your products or services is a unique way to build community and authenticity. User-generated content (UGC) allows for genuine connections, as other customers see real people using your offerings.
Create campaigns that encourage customers to share their photos through social media, using a branded hashtag. Highlight these submissions in your emails to showcase your active community and illustrate the real-life applications of your products or services.
Not only does this showcase your brand in an authentic light, but it also encourages community engagement and loyalty. New customers will see the trust and satisfaction existing customers have, enhancing their own likelihood to convert.
7. Seasonal or Holiday-Themed Content
Creating seasonal or holiday-themed campaigns is a fun way to keep your audience engaged throughout the year. Tailoring your content to align with specific holidays provides an opportunity for timely promotions and connection.
For example, craft emails that highlight holiday sales, special promotions, or themed blog posts relevant to the season. An email titled “Get Ready for Summer with Our Special Deals!” can create a sense of urgency and excitement.
Seasonal content keeps your brand relevant and strengthens customer relationships, as it shows you’re in tune with their needs throughout the year.
8. Collaborate with Influencers or Local Businesses
Partnering with influencers or other local businesses can expand your reach and introduce your brand to new audiences. Collaborations can take many forms, from joint giveaways to shared content.
Consider featuring local influencers trying out your products or services in your emails. Their testimonials or endorsements can lend credibility and attract followers to your brand.
Additionally, collaborating with complementary local businesses allows you to cross-promote offerings, benefitting both your brand and your partner’s presence in the community.
